1. What types of jobs are available in the cannabis industry?

In various industries, including cannabis, there's a wide array of roles demanding specific skills and expertise. Within the cannabis sector, you'll discover diverse job opportunities like budtenders, cultivators, extractors, dispensary managers, compliance officers, and marketing professionals. To pinpoint the ideal role for you, consider your interests and aptitudes. If you're passionate about hands-on work with cannabis plants, explore plant-touching positions. If you're transitioning from another industry, seek out cannabis roles with similar job titles. Unsure where to start? 2. Do I need prior experience to work in the cannabis industry?

While some companies may prioritize candidates with prior cannabis experience, there are lots of companies who offer opportunities to individuals without prior industry experience, especially for entry-level roles.

3. Can working at a dispensary impact my future employment opportunities?

Working in a dispensary can actually enhance your future job prospects. It shows your adaptability, customer service skills, and knowledge about a highly regulated industry. Plus, it's a great way to build a professional network and gain experience in a growing field.

4. Is the cannabis job market competitive?

Yes, the cannabis job market can be competitive, especially in regions with well-established industries. Hiring managers often prioritize candidates with industry experience and knowledge, so staying updated on industry trends and networking can give you a competitive edge.

6. What are the typical salary ranges for cannabis jobs?

Salaries in the cannabis industry vary widely. Budtenders might start at minimum wage, while experienced cultivators or managers can earn six-figure salaries, depending on location and company size. Learn more in our yearly Vangst Salary Guide Report.

7. Are there remote job opportunities in the cannabis industry?

Cannabis, primarily a CPG and Agricultural industry, involves significant product and plant-related tasks, limiting remote work options for many roles. Yet, like other industries, certain corporate functions like Marketing, Compliance, and Software Development can be conducted remotely.

8. What challenges do employers face when hiring in the cannabis industry?

Employers in the cannabis industry often grapple with navigating complex regulations and finding candidates who understand these rules. They also face stigma associated with the plant. These factors have all contributed to a high turnover rate for cannabis verticals such as Retail, Cultivation, and Manufacturing, especially in entry-level roles.

10. What is the future outlook for cannabis careers?

The future of cannabis careers looks promising, with continued growth and potential federal legalization in the United States. More opportunities and diverse roles are expected to emerge as the industry matures.
